Marlins Probable Starter Braxton Garrett
- The Marlins are sending Garrett (1-3) to the mound to make his ninth start of the season. He is 1-3 with a 3.70 ERA and 40 strikeouts in 41 1/3 innings pitched.
- His last time out came on Thursday, July 14 against the Pittsburgh Pirates, when the lefty went 6 2/3 scoreless innings while giving up two hits.
- The 24-year-old has put up an ERA of 3.70, with 8.7 strikeouts per nine innings, in eight games this season. Opponents are batting .255 against him.
- Garrett is looking to record his third quality start of the year.
- The opposing Pirates offense has a collective .221 batting average, and is 28th in the league with 676 total hits and 28th in MLB action with 339 runs scored. It has the 28th-ranked slugging percentage (.369) and ranks 15th in home runs (96) in all of MLB.

Pirates Probable Starter Zach Thompson
- Thompson (3-6) will take the mound for the Pirates, his 16th start of the season.
- The right-hander last pitched on Thursday, July 14, when he gave up one earned run and allowed four hits in 6 2/3 innings against the Miami Marlins.
- The 28-year-old has pitched in 16 games this season with an ERA of 4.09 and 6.3 strikeouts per nine innings, with an opponent batting average of .249.
- In 15 starts this season, he’s earned two quality starts.
- The Marlins are batting .236 this season, 23rd in MLB. They have a team slugging percentage of .377 (24th in the league) with 90 home runs.

Marlins Players to Watch
- Garrett Cooper has racked up a team-high OBP (.347) and slugging percentage (.432), and paces the Marlins in hits (83). He’s hitting .282 with 21 doubles, a triple, seven home runs and 26 walks.
- Among qualifying hitters in MLB play, Cooper’s batting average ranks 34th, his on-base percentage ranks 46th, and he is 66th in the league in slugging.
- Jesus Aguilar has 14 doubles, 11 home runs and 21 walks while hitting .246.
- Aguilar currently ranks 95th in batting average, 127th in on base percentage, and 104th in slugging among qualifying batters.
- Miguel Rojas is batting .234 with 11 doubles, a triple, six home runs and 17 walks.
- Jorge Soler is batting .206 with 13 doubles, 13 home runs and 31 walks.

Pirates Players to Watch
- Ke’Bryan Hayes leads Pittsburgh with a slugging percentage of .356, fueled by 23 extra-base hits.
- Among all the qualifying batters in the big leagues, Hayes’ batting average is 82nd, his on-base percentage is 83rd, and he is 137th in slugging.
- Daniel Vogelbach is slugging .426 while driving in 34 runs and batting .228 this season.
- Michael Chavis has 59 hits this season and has a slash line of .240/.280/.419.
- Ben Gamel is batting .249 with a .335 OBP and 22 RBI for Pittsburgh this season.
